Hono - Schnell und leichtgewichtig für Webanwendungen
Aktualisiert am 2025-03-04
AI Programmierassistent
AI-Entwicklungstools
AI Website-Bautool
Hono ist ein modernes Webanwendungs-Framework, das für Geschwindigkeit und Modularität entwickelt wurde. Mit einem unglaublichen Gewicht von unter 14 kB im hono/tiny-Preset und der Nutzung von Webstandard-APIs, bietet Hono eine ultraschnelle Lösung für Entwickler. Ob Sie auf Cloudflare, Fastly, Deno, Bun, AWS oder Node.js arbeiten, Hono läuft überall gleich. Zudem kommen Sie mit einer Vielzahl von eingebauten Middleware, benutzerdefinierten Middleware und Unterstützung für Drittanbieter-Middleware, passend zu Ihrer Entwicklung. Dank der sauberen APIs und erstklassigen Unterstützung für TypeScript, ist Hono die ideale Wahl für moderne Anwendungen.
Entdecken Sie Hono, das ultraschnelle Webanwendungs-Framework, das auf Webstandards basiert und Kompatibilität mit allen JavaScript-Runtimes bietet. Perfekt für Entwickler, die auf der Suche nach einer leichtgewichtigen Lösung sind, die sowohl Geschwindigkeit als auch Flexibilität vereint. Mit Hono können Sie sicher sein, dass Ihr Code überall lauffähig ist!
Hono bietet eine Architektur, die auf Webstandards aufbaut und die Entwicklung von Anwendungen vereinfacht. Die Hauptmerkmale umfassen: • Ultraschnelle Router: Der RegExpRouter von Hono ist hochoptimiert für Geschwindigkeit, um Anfragen blitzschnell zu verarbeiten. • Modularität: Entwickeln Sie Anwendungen mit der Einfachheit, die Hono für alle JavaScript-Runtimes bietet. • Eingebaute Middleware: Vordefinierte und benutzerdefinierte Middleware ermöglichen es Entwicklern, Funktionalitäten einfach hinzuzufügen. • Erstklassige TypeScript-Unterstützung: Optimierte API für Entwickler, die Typensicherheit und -kontrolle benötigen. • Flexibilität: Egal, ob in der Cloud oder auf einem lokalen Server, Ihr Hono-Code funktioniert überall gleich.
Um Hono optimal zu nutzen, gehen Sie wie folgt vor:
Installation: Beginnen Sie mit der Installation von Hono über npm. Führen Sie den Befehl npm install hono aus, um das Framework zu Ihrem Projekt hinzuzufügen.
Erstellen einer Anwendung: Erstellen Sie Ihre Anwendung, indem Sie eine Instanz von Hono erzeugen und Ihre Routen definieren. Beispiel:
Middleware nutzen: Verwenden Sie die eingebauten Middleware für Authentifizierung, Logging oder andere Funktionalitäten.
Deployment: Bereitstellung Ihrer Anwendung auf einer beliebigen unterstützten Plattform wie AWS oder Cloudflare. Einfacher Export und kompilieren erforderlich.
Hono ist ein leistungsstarkes und flexibles Webanwendungs-Framework, das Ihnen die schnellste und leichtgewichtigste Anwendungsentwicklung ermöglicht. Egal, welche JavaScript-Runtime Sie verwenden, Hono bietet Ihnen alle Werkzeuge und Ressourcen, die Sie benötigen, um Ihre Anwendung schnell zu entwickeln und bereitzustellen. Probieren Sie Hono noch heute aus und genießen Sie eine erstklassige Entwicklungserfahrung!
Funktionen
Ultraschnelle Router
RegExpRouter für blitzschnelle Anfragenverarbeitung.
Multi-Runtime Unterstützung
Funktioniert nahtlos auf Cloudflare, Fastly, Deno, Bun und mehr.
Integrierte Middleware
Bietet benutzerdefinierte und Drittanbieter-Middleware für erweiterte Funktionalität.
Einfache APIs
Super saubere und verständliche APIs erleichtern die Entwicklung.
Erstklassige TypeScript-Unterstützung
Vollständige Unterstützung für Typen, um Ihnen zu helfen, Fehler zu vermeiden.
Leichtgewichtig
Das hono/tiny-Preset wiegt unter 14kB für maximale Leistung.
Anwendungsfälle
Entwicklung von Webanwendungen
Webentwickler
Start-ups
Ideal für die Entwicklung moderner Webanwendungen, die schnell und effektiv bereitgestellt werden müssen.
Cloud-basierte Lösungen
Cloud-Ingenieure
DevOps-Teams
Perfekt für die Erstellung und das Management von cloud-basierten Anwendungen auf Plattformen wie AWS oder Cloudflare.
Echtzeit-Anwendungen
Softwareentwickler
Start-ups
Eignet sich hervorragend für die Entwicklung von Echtzeit-Anwendungen. Die Geschwindigkeit von Hono ermöglicht schnelle Reaktionen auf Benutzeranfragen.
API-Entwicklung
API-Entwickler
Unternehmen
Ein ausgezeichnetes Werkzeug für die Entwicklung von APIs, die schnell und ressourcenschonend arbeiten müssen.
Prototyping
Produktmanager
Start-up-Teams
Seine Modularität ermöglicht es Teams, schnell Prototypen zu erstellen und zu testen.
Webservices für IoT
IoT-Entwickler
Technologieteams
Bieten Sie Webservices, die mit IoT-Applikationen schnell und effizient kommunizieren.